会议专题

A Load-Balancing Dynamic Scheduling Algorithm under Machine Failure Conditions

A load-balancing dynamic scheduling (LBDS) algorithm is proposed in this paper, which is concentrated on the how-to-reschedule issue with interruptions of machine failures. It adjusts the original scheme based on the principle of balancing load and minimizing the makespan. Three rules are considered in our algorithm: (1) priority rule regarding makespan and due date, (2) priority rule regarding processing time and machine unused time segment, and (3) the rule that all machines will be added unused time segment if there is no matching one. The performance of this algorithm is compared with the traditional earliest-due-date-based scheduling strategy algorithms. Simulation results show that the proposed algorithm performs better in more balanced load and less changes to the original scheduling result.

dynamic scheduling load-balancing machine failure

Wenmin Miao Dongni Li Wei Zhang

School of Computer Science, Beijing Institute of Technology, Beijing, China 100081

国际会议

2010 International Conference on Intelligent Computation Technology and Automation(2010 智能计算技术与自动化国际会议 ICICTA 2010)

长沙

英文

144-147

2010-05-11(万方平台首次上网日期,不代表论文的发表时间)